Sewage, the waste produced by humans and animals, contains harmful bacteria and viruses that can cause serious health problems. Exposure to sewage can occur through contact with contaminated water, soil, or air. Sewage cleanup services are essential for protecting public health and preventing the spread of disease.

Yes, sewage fumes can be harmful. Sewage fumes contain methane, hydrogen sulfide, and other gases that can cause respiratory problems, such as coughing, wheezing, and shortness of breath. In high concentrations, sewage fumes can be fatal.
